Are you worried about getting adequate protein on a plant-based diet? Complete vegan proteins are plant-based foods that contain all nine essential amino acids your body cannot produce on its own. These include histidine, isoleucine, leucine, lysine, methionine, phenylalanine, threonine, tryptophan, and valine. Understanding which vegan foods qualify as complete proteins eliminates the guesswork from plant-based nutrition planning.
Understanding the Science Behind Complete Vegan Proteins
Your body requires 20 amino acids to build proteins, but it can synthesize only 11 of them. The remaining nine must come from food. Animal products naturally contain all essential amino acids in adequate ratios. Plant proteins, however, typically lack sufficient quantities of one or more essential amino acids, particularly lysine and methionine.
The biological value of protein measures how efficiently your body can use it. According to the Protein Digestibility-Corrected Amino Acid Score (PDCAAS) developed by the Food and Agriculture Organization, a complete protein scores close to 1.0. Most plant proteins score between 0.5 and 0.9, but several vegan sources achieve complete protein status.
7 Complete Vegan Proteins You Can Eat Daily
Soy-Based Foods Lead the Complete Vegan Proteins Category
Soybeans and their derivatives rank as the most versatile complete proteins in plant-based nutrition. Tofu, tempeh, edamame, and soy milk all provide the full amino acid spectrum. A cup of cooked soybeans delivers approximately 29 grams of protein with a PDCAAS of 1.0, matching animal protein quality.
Tempeh offers additional benefits through fermentation, which enhances nutrient bioavailability and adds beneficial probiotics. Research from the Academy of Nutrition and Dietetics confirms that soy protein supports muscle synthesis as effectively as whey protein when consumed in adequate amounts.
Quinoa: The Ancient Grain Complete Protein
Quinoa stands alone among grains as a complete protein source. This pseudocereal contains all nine essential amino acids, with particularly high lysine content compared to wheat or rice. One cup of cooked quinoa provides 8 grams of protein and offers a complete amino acid profile that makes it valuable for vegan athletes and active individuals.
The grain’s protein content ranges from 14-18% by dry weight, significantly higher than most cereals. Its amino acid balance closely resembles the ideal pattern recommended by the World Health Organization.
Hemp Seeds Pack Dense Nutrition
Three tablespoons of hemp seeds contain 10 grams of complete protein with exceptional digestibility. Hemp protein contains adequate amounts of all essential amino acids, particularly arginine and glutamic acid. The seeds also provide omega-3 and omega-6 fatty acids in an optimal 3:1 ratio.
Chia Seeds Deliver Surprising Protein Quality
Despite their small size, chia seeds qualify as complete vegan proteins with all nine essential amino acids present in sufficient quantities. Two tablespoons provide 4 grams of protein along with substantial fiber and omega-3 content. The protein content reaches 14% by weight, with particularly strong showings in tryptophan and phenylalanine.
Buckwheat Defies Its Name
Buckwheat contains no wheat and serves as another pseudocereal with complete protein status. It provides high-quality protein with excellent lysine levels, the amino acid most often limiting in plant proteins. Buckwheat’s protein digestibility exceeds 80%, comparable to many animal proteins.
Spirulina: The Algae Protein Powerhouse
This blue-green algae contains 60-70% protein by dry weight, making it one of the most protein-dense foods available. A single tablespoon of spirulina powder provides 4 grams of complete protein. The amino acid profile matches the FAO reference pattern closely, though some experts debate its methionine content adequacy.
Ezekiel Bread Through Strategic Combination
Ezekiel bread combines sprouted grains and legumes to create a complete protein profile. The specific combination of wheat, barley, beans, lentils, millet, and spelt provides all essential amino acids. Two slices deliver 8 grams of complete protein through complementary amino acid profiles.
The Protein Complementation Myth Debunked
Outdated nutritional advice insisted you must combine specific plant proteins at every meal to create complete proteins. This stems from Frances Moore Lappé’s 1971 book “Diet for a Small Planet,” which she later revised. Your body maintains an amino acid pool, drawing from proteins consumed throughout the day.
The American Dietetic Association confirms that consuming various protein sources over the day provides all essential amino acids without requiring meticulous meal-by-meal combinations. Your liver stores and releases amino acids as needed, making strategic timing unnecessary for most people.
Comparing Amino Acid Profiles of Top Vegan Sources
| Food Source | Protein per 100g | PDCAAS Score | Limiting Amino Acid |
|---|---|---|---|
| Soybeans | 36g | 1.0 | None |
| Quinoa | 14g | 0.87 | None (trace lysine) |
| Hemp Seeds | 32g | 0.66 | Lysine (minor) |
| Spirulina | 57g | 0.82 | Methionine (debated) |
| Chia Seeds | 17g | 0.78 | None |
Practical Implementation Strategy
Meeting protein requirements on a vegan diet becomes straightforward when you incorporate complete vegan proteins strategically. Adult protein needs range from 0.8 to 1.2 grams per kilogram of body weight daily, with athletes requiring higher amounts.
Building a Complete Vegan Proteins Meal Plan
Start your day with chia pudding or quinoa porridge for 8-10 grams of complete protein. Add hemp seeds to smoothies or salads for mid-day protein boosts. Include tofu, tempeh, or edamame in lunch and dinner preparations for 15-20 grams per serving.
A sample daily intake might include:
- Breakfast: Quinoa bowl with hemp seeds (15g protein)
- Lunch: Tempeh Buddha bowl (20g protein)
- Snack: Spirulina smoothie (8g protein)
- Dinner: Tofu stir-fry with buckwheat noodles (25g protein)
This approach delivers 68 grams of complete protein without combining foods or tracking individual amino acids.
Troubleshooting Common Protein Adequacy Concerns
Athletes and highly active individuals often question whether complete vegan proteins support performance and recovery. Research published in nutrition journals demonstrates that plant-based athletes achieve similar muscle protein synthesis rates when consuming adequate total protein and calories.
The key lies in volume. Plant proteins contain more fiber and bulk than concentrated animal proteins, requiring larger portion sizes. If you struggle with satiety, focus on concentrated sources like tofu, tempeh, and protein-fortified plant milks rather than relying solely on whole grains and legumes.
Expert Opinion: The Leucine Threshold Consideration
While most discussion focuses on complete amino acid profiles, leucine content deserves attention for muscle building. This branched-chain amino acid triggers muscle protein synthesis most effectively. Soy products, particularly soy protein isolate, contain leucine levels comparable to whey. Other complete vegan proteins like hemp and spirulina provide adequate leucine when consumed in sufficient quantities, though you may need larger servings compared to soy or animal proteins.
Beyond Completeness: Protein Quality Factors
Complete amino acid profiles tell only part of the story. Digestibility affects how much protein your body actually absorbs and uses. Soybeans score highest among plant proteins for digestibility at 91%. Sprouting, fermenting, and cooking increase protein digestibility by breaking down anti-nutritional factors like phytates and trypsin inhibitors.
Combining complete vegan proteins with vitamin C-rich foods enhances iron absorption from plant sources. Pairing tofu with bell peppers or adding lemon juice to quinoa bowls maximizes nutrient bioavailability.
Meeting Increased Protein Needs on Plants
Pregnancy, lactation, illness recovery, and intense training increase protein requirements. The International Society of Sports Nutrition recommends 1.6-2.2 grams per kilogram for athletes building muscle. Vegan athletes can meet these targets by consuming complete vegan proteins at each meal and incorporating concentrated sources like protein powders derived from soy, pea, or hemp.
Splitting protein intake across 4-5 meals optimizes muscle protein synthesis better than consuming large amounts in one sitting. Aim for 20-30 grams per meal from complete sources to maximize leucine exposure and anabolic response.
